扁平苔蘚皮損中VEGF、p-Akt、Survivin表達(dá)與凋亡的關(guān)系

【摘要】: 目的:研究VEGF、p-Akt和Survivin蛋白在扁平苔蘚皮損中的表達(dá)情況以及與扁平苔蘚皮損中細(xì)胞凋亡的關(guān)系,探討PI3K/Akt信號(hào)通路和細(xì)胞凋亡在扁平苔蘚發(fā)病中的作用。 方法:采用免疫組織化學(xué)法檢測(cè)30例扁平苔蘚皮損及30例正常皮膚組織標(biāo)本中VEGF、p-Akt和Survivin的表達(dá)情況和表達(dá)部位。采用原位末端標(biāo)記技術(shù)(TUNEL)法檢測(cè)皮損處細(xì)胞凋亡的情況。并對(duì)VEGF、p-Akt和Survivin在皮損中的表達(dá)水平進(jìn)行相關(guān)性分析。 結(jié)果:VEGF、p-Akt和Survivin的表達(dá)均以細(xì)胞漿著黃色或棕黃色顆粒為陽(yáng)性,采用積分光密度(integrated optical density, IOD)值的大小表示陽(yáng)性表達(dá)強(qiáng)度。扁平苔蘚皮損中VEGF、p-Akt和Survivin的IOD值分別為13.584±1.131、14.405±1.263和10.537±1.212均明顯高于正常對(duì)照組(P0.01),并且三項(xiàng)指標(biāo)的表達(dá)水平呈正相關(guān)(P0.01)。扁平苔蘚組皮損處表皮角質(zhì)形成細(xì)胞的凋亡指數(shù)(apoptosis index, AI)為72.817±9.234,明顯高于正常對(duì)照組28.160±3.464(P0.01)。 結(jié)論:扁平苔蘚皮損表皮角質(zhì)形成細(xì)胞高表達(dá)的VEGF可能通過(guò)PI3K/Akt信號(hào)通路使Survivin的表達(dá)增高。PI3K/Akt信號(hào)通路可能參與了扁平苔蘚的發(fā)病。扁平苔蘚皮損處同時(shí)存在角質(zhì)形成細(xì)胞的過(guò)度增殖和凋亡亢進(jìn)。
[Abstract]:Aim: to investigate the expression of VEGFP-Akt and survivin protein in the lesions of lichen planus and the relationship between the expression of VEGFP-Akt and apoptosis in lichen planus and to explore the role of PI3K / Akt signaling pathway and apoptosis in the pathogenesis of lichen planus. Methods: the expression and location of VEGFP-Akt and survivin in 30 cases of lichen planus lesions and 30 cases of normal skin tissue were detected by immunohistochemical method. In situ end labeling (Tunel) was used to detect apoptosis in lesions. The expression levels of VEGF-Akt and survivin in skin lesions were analyzed. Results the positive expression of the cell cytoplasm was yellow or brown granules, and the intensity of the positive expression was indicated by the value of integrated optical density (integrated optical density,). The IOD values of VEGFP-Akt and survivin in lichen planus lesions were 13.584 鹵1.131, 14.405 鹵1.263 and 10.537 鹵1.212, respectively, which were significantly higher than those in the normal control group (P0.01), and the expression levels of the three indexes were positively correlated (P0.01). The apoptotic index (apoptosis index, AI) of epidermal keratinocytes in the lichen planus group was 72.817 鹵9.234, which was significantly higher than that in the normal control group (28.160 鹵3.464). Conclusion: the overexpression of VEGF in epidermal keratinocytes of lichen planus may increase the expression of survivin through PI3K / Akt signaling pathway. PI3K / Akt signaling pathway may be involved in the pathogenesis of lichen planus. Excessive proliferation and apoptosis of keratinocytes exist in the lesions of lichen planus.
